Supporting Cleanliness and Hygiene


1. Reduces Cross-Contamination Risks


Using disposable plates, spoons, and cups eliminates the chance of germs spreading from poorly washed reusable items. In offices with high staff turnover or shared facilities, this simple measure enhances hygiene and safety.



2. Ensures One-Time Use Per Person


Items like individually packed forks, knives, and cups make it easy to assign one per person—especially important during health-sensitive periods like flu season or post-COVID protocol implementation.



3. Keeps the Pantry Tidy and Odour-Free


Without dirty dishes left in sinks or stained containers, the pantry stays cleaner throughout the day. This also reduces pest problems, unpleasant smells, and overuse of dishwashing supplies.



Saving Time and Increasing Convenience


4. No Need for Washing or Drying


Disposable items remove the need for dishwashing, which saves time for employees and housekeeping staff. It allows everyone to focus on work rather than cleaning duties during or after meal times.



5. Quick Setup and Cleanup for Office Events


Whether it's a team lunch, client meeting, or birthday celebration, disposable catering supplies make serving and cleaning up incredibly efficient. Items can be used, packed, and thrown away without much hassle.



6. Ideal for Out-of-Pantry Meetings


If your office frequently holds meetings in different rooms or has a mobile team, disposable items allow refreshments to be served anywhere without worrying about returning dishes.



Practicality for Daily and Occasional Use


7. Fits Any Pantry Budget


Disposable catering supplies are affordable and available in various quality ranges. Whether you’re stocking for daily use or planning monthly events, they offer a cost-effective solution for managing pantry needs.



8. Available in Different Sizes and Materials


From 6oz paper cups to large catering trays, you can choose items to suit different food types and serving quantities. This flexibility ensures you’re always prepared, no matter the menu.



9. No Storage or Transport Hassle


Unlike ceramic or glassware, disposables are lightweight, easy to stack, and don’t break. This makes storage safer and transportation easier when setting up for large groups or off-site events.



Improving Pantry Efficiency and Staff Satisfaction


10. Encourages Inclusivity During Meals


Having enough disposable items ensures no one is left out during office meals due to a lack of clean utensils or plates. It fosters a sense of inclusivity and shared culture.



11. Enhances Pantry Accessibility for Visitors


Clients, vendors, or part-time staff who drop by can also enjoy refreshments without worrying about where or how to clean up after. This improves your organisation’s hospitality image.



12. Makes Restocking and Inventory Management Easier


Since disposables are used in bulk and packed in uniform quantities, tracking stock levels becomes simpler. You’ll always know when it’s time to reorder, avoiding last-minute shortages.



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. What types of disposable items should an office stock?


Start with paper cups, plastic or biodegradable plates, cutlery, napkins, and serving trays. Add optional items like disposable gloves and drink stirrers depending on your pantry setup.



2. Are disposables environmentally friendly?


While traditional plastic items aren’t eco-friendly, there are now many biodegradable or compostable options made from corn starch, sugarcane, or bamboo that reduce environmental impact.



3. Can we reuse disposables in small offices?


Technically no—disposables are meant for single use only. However, high-quality items like thicker plastic cups may be reused a limited number of times if cleaned properly (though not recommended for shared use).



4. How should disposables be stored?


Keep them in a dry, dust-free cabinet or storage box. Store by category (cups, plates, cutlery) and label them clearly to avoid confusion during busy times.



5. How often should we restock pantry supplies?


Depending on the office size, check pantry stock weekly. High-use items like cups and spoons may require bi-weekly or monthly restocking, especially during festive or team-building months.
